What is a 24V Parking Cooler?


A **24V parking cooler** is a specialized air conditioning unit designed for vehicles, particularly those with a 24-volt electrical system, such as trucks, buses, and RVs. Unlike conventional air conditioning systems that rely on the vehicle's engine to operate, a parking cooler can function independently, allowing for cooling without the engine running. This innovative device is particularly beneficial for users who spend extended periods in their vehicles, delivering comfort and a refreshing environment.

How Does a 24V Parking Cooler Work?


The operation of a **24V parking cooler** is straightforward yet effective. It typically employs a combination of **evaporative cooling** or **refrigeration technology** to cool the air. Here’s a breakdown of how it functions:


Evaporative Cooling


Some parking coolers use evaporative cooling, which involves drawing in warm air and passing it through a wet medium. As the air evaporates the moisture, it cools down, providing a refreshing breeze inside the vehicle. This method is energy-efficient and effective in dry climates.


Refrigeration Technology


Alternatively, many **24V parking coolers** utilize refrigeration technology, similar to conventional air conditioners. This system compresses refrigerant to cool the air, producing a steady stream of chilled air. While slightly more energy-intensive, this method is effective in maintaining a consistently low temperature, even in humid conditions.

Frequently Asked Questions (FAQs)


1. Can I use a 24V parking cooler with a 12V vehicle?


No, a **24V parking cooler** is specifically designed to operate with a 24V electrical system. Using it with a 12V vehicle could damage the unit and the vehicle's electrical system.


2. How long can a 24V parking cooler run on battery power?


The runtime of a **24V parking cooler** on battery power depends on the cooler's energy consumption and the battery capacity. Typically, they can run for several hours, but it's essential to monitor battery levels to prevent drainage.


3. Are parking coolers easy to install?


Yes, most **24V parking coolers** come with straightforward installation instructions and require basic tools. However, if you're uncomfortable with electrical work, consider seeking professional help.


4. Do parking coolers require regular maintenance?


Yes, regular maintenance, including cleaning filters and checking electrical connections, is crucial for optimal performance and longevity.


5. Can I leave the cooler running while parked?


Yes, a **24V parking cooler** can be left running while parked, allowing you to enjoy a cool environment without needing to keep the engine on. However, always monitor battery levels to prevent draining.
